autoplan

An automated review process that reads CEO, design, engineering, and developer-experience review guidance, then combines those reviews into one plan. It makes routine decisions automatically and saves subjective choices for a final approval step.

In plain words
What is it for?
Use it to turn a rough plan into a reviewed implementation plan covering product direction, design, engineering, and developer experience.
Why use it?
It reduces the need to run several review processes separately and keeps their recommendations together.

/autoplan — Auto-Review Pipeline

One command. Rough plan in, fully reviewed plan out.

/autoplan reads the full CEO, design, eng, and DX review skill files from disk and follows them at full depth — same rigor, same sections, same methodology as running each skill manually. The only difference: intermediate AskUserQuestion calls are auto-decided using the 6 principles below. Taste decisions (where reasonable people could disagree) are surfaced at a final approval gate.


The 6 Decision Principles

These rules auto-answer every intermediate question:

  1. Choose completeness — Ship the whole thing. Pick the approach that covers more edge cases.
  2. Boil lakes — Fix everything in the blast radius (files modified by this plan + direct importers). Auto-approve expansions that are in blast radius AND < 1 day CC effort (< 5 files, no new infra).
  3. Pragmatic — If two options fix the same thing, pick the cleaner one. 5 seconds choosing, not 5 minutes.
  4. DRY — Duplicates existing functionality? Reject. Reuse what exists.
  5. Explicit over clever — 10-line obvious fix > 200-line abstraction. Pick what a new contributor reads in 30 seconds.
  6. Bias toward action — Merge > review cycles > stale deliberation. Flag concerns but don't block.

Conflict resolution (context-dependent tiebreakers):

  • CEO phase: P1 (completeness) + P2 (boil lakes) dominate.
  • Eng phase: P5 (explicit) + P3 (pragmatic) dominate.
  • Design phase: P5 (explicit) + P1 (completeness) dominate.

Decision Classification

Every auto-decision is classified:

Mechanical — one clearly right answer. Auto-decide silently. Examples: run codex (always yes), run evals (always yes), reduce scope on a complete plan (always no).

Taste — reasonable people could disagree. Auto-decide with recommendation, but surface at the final gate. Three natural sources:

  1. Close approaches — top two are both viable with different tradeoffs.
  2. Borderline scope — in blast radius but 3-5 files, or ambiguous radius.
  3. outside-voice sub-agent disagreements — codex recommends differently and has a valid point.
